The Impact of Moisture on Paint Drying Time



You're most likely questioning exactly how the moisture outside can impact your paint job, well let me inform you, it can really slow down the drying out time of your paint!

When the air is moist, it is filled with dampness, and this can cause your paint to take much longer to completely dry than it would certainly in a drier atmosphere. This is because the water in the paint requires to vaporize in order for the paint to dry, and when the air is already filled with dampness, it can't soak up anymore, which decreases the drying process.

The influence of humidity on your painting job can be a lot more considerable if you are repainting in an improperly ventilated location, as the moisture in the air will certainly have no place to go, and will just linger around your task, making the drying out time even much longer.

The most effective way to deal with the results of moisture on your paint job is to choose a day when the climate is completely dry, or to repaint during a time of day when the humidity is reduced, such as very early in the morning or later at night. Additionally, you can utilize a dehumidifier or a fan to assist flow the air and quicken the drying time.

Tips for Selecting the very best Weather Conditions for Your Home Painting Project



Optimum paint conditions need cautious consideration of elements such as temperature level, humidity, and wind speed to make sure a smooth and even end up. When intending your house painting project, it is very important to pick the most effective weather conditions to stay clear of any type of incidents or hold-ups.

Right here are some pointers to help you select the right weather for your painting job:


- Examine the weather report: Before starting your job, make sure to inspect the weather prediction for the next couple of days. Avoid painting on days with high humidity or solid winds, as these problems can impact the paint's adhesion and drying out time.

- Go for modest temperatures: Extreme temperatures can influence the uniformity of the paint and create it to completely dry too rapidly or otherwise at all. Aim for temperatures between 50 and 85 degrees Fahrenheit for optimal painting conditions.

- Stay clear of straight sunshine: Paint in straight sunlight can create the paint to completely dry also promptly, resulting in irregular protection and blistering. Pick a day with partial shade or wait till the sun has passed over your home.

- Take into consideration the time of day: Painting in the late afternoon or early evening can be a good alternative as the temperature and humidity degrees tend to be lower. Nonetheless, see to it to end up paint prior to it gets as well dark to avoid any kind of mistakes.

By taking these aspects into consideration, you can make certain that your house painting project is a success, with a smooth and also end up that will last for many years ahead.
